Get out and explore Chelsea while you take a break from studying. The neighborhood has a wide variety of attractions nearby, as it is located in the heart of Manhattan. You can start your day at the Chelsea Market, which is a one-square-block indoor market. With over 35 vendors, the market has become one of the greatest indoor food halls in the world. The location is packed with foods from around the world. This foodie mecca is a great place to sample and purchase some of the best quality foods in the state.
If you're looking for a great place to watch a game or see a live show, visit Madison Square Garden. The venue is a world leader in live sports and entertainment. With seating for nearly 20,000 at concerts and 18,000 for sports events, the location can really pack in an audience. There is almost always something happening there, so check their website for options.
